GI leader to know: Dr. Joseph F. Hacker III of Gastroenterology Associates

Joseph F. Hacker III, MD, is a gastroenterologist and the president of Newark, Del.-based Gastroenterology Associates.

Dr. Hacker specializes gastroesophageal reflux disease, peptic ulcer disease and colon cancer among others.

His career began after he earned his medical degree from Philadelphia's Hahnemann Medical College (now Drexel University). He completed his internship, residency and fellowship at the Bethesda, Md.-based Naval Hospital before he spent nine years in the Navy.

Dr. Hacker is a diplomate of the American Board of Internal Medicine and the National Board of Medical Examiners.

He is a fellow of the American College of Gastroenterology.
